Balancing the Playing Field: Carbon Border Adjustment Mechanisms for a Sustainable Future

As global economies transition towards a low-carbon future, ensuring a level playing field becomes paramount. Emissions click here border adjustment mechanisms (CBAMs) are emerging as a potent tool to achieve this goal. By implementing tariffs on imports from countries with less stringent climate policies, CBAMs aim to discourage carbon-intensive production abroad and promote domestic industries to adopt sustainable practices. This approach not only reduces global emissions but also safeguards fair competition for businesses operating within robust environmental regulations.

Conversely, CBAMs are a complex policy instrument with potential implications. Careful implementation is crucial to avoid hindering global trade and affecting developing economies disproportionately. Moreover, robust international cooperation and evaluation mechanisms are essential to ensure the effectiveness and fairness of CBAMs in fostering a truly sustainable future.

Navigating Complexity: Implementing Effective Carbon Border Adjustment Mechanisms

Implementing successful carbon border adjustment mechanisms (CBAMs) presents a significant dilemma for policymakers globally. To guarantee fairness and alleviate the risk of pollution relocation, CBAMs must be carefully crafted to faithfully reflect the true costs of carbon emissions. A key aspect is establishing a transparent and reliable system for assessing carbon intensity across different jurisdictions. Furthermore, CBAMs should be implemented in a stepwise manner to allow firms time to adapt and minimize impact.

  • International partnership is crucial for the efficacy of CBAMs, as carbon emissions are transboundary in nature.
  • Ongoing assessment and refinement of CBAMs will be essential to ensure their success over time.
